Helicobacter pylori Infection in Dialysis Patients: A Meta-Analysis
Background. Infection with Helicobacter pylori contributes to the etiopathogenesis of various extragastrointestinal conditions, yet its etiological association with either symptomatic or asymptomatic dialysis patients remains inconclusive.
